PRESS RELEASE: ChildFund Uganda has disbursed funds worth UGX 1.4 billion to 9 local partners to implement cash transfers to 29,000 enrolled households. This contribution is to complement @GovUganda efforts towards alleviating #COVID19 burden on vulnerable households.
Stanley Muganga, a resident of Makerere Kavule has ridden his sister on a wheelbarrow to the Kawempe Referral Hospital.
Muganga says ambulances had been asking for a lot of money for hire & also claimed that other ambulances were just driving past him.
